Transforming library service in Superior Township & Willow Run

On election night, when the Ypsilanti District Library’s millage passed with 67% of the vote, we cheered and celebrated—and we’re sure you did too! It’s an incredible finish to our 150th anniversary year, and an undeniable affirmation of the value of our library. Now we begin a new chapter in its history.

Thank you! Because of voters like you, our collection will include the latest books and movies, job-seekers will use updated technology to learn computer skills, and kids will enjoy enriching art, science, and writing programs along with free lunches in the summer.

Now, because of you, YDL will do something truly transformational—build a new, full-service library in an area where it’s desperately needed, and operate that library for decades to come.

“We keep track of all our reference questions. The #1 question we get asked is ‘how do I get on a computer.’ The second most common question is ‘when are you guys moving into a bigger space?’ Now I finally have an answer!”
– Mary Garboden, Superior Branch Manager

It’s hard to overstate the difference the new library will make in the MacArthur Boulevard and Willow Run communities. The current, tiny library is about the size of a two-car garage, but it has an out-sized impact on the surrounding neighborhood.

“The library is the best thing in this whole area. It’s the only thing we have for our kids. I know my kids can come here and play and be safe.” – Sentra, neighborhood resident and mother

The new library will have double the hours of the current location, 20 computers compared to the current 7, dedicated youth and teen areas instead of the current tiny, 50-square-foot kids’ corner, and a community room to host special programs these kids may otherwise never experience.
